Journal Prompts about Justice and fairness

Certainly! Here are 8 journal prompts that explore justice and fairness from a biblical perspective:

  1. Reflect on Micah 6:8: "He has shown you, O mortal, what is good. And what does the Lord require of you? To act justly and to love mercy and to walk humbly with your God." How do you personally fulfill this command in your daily life? What changes can you make to better align with God’s requirements for justice?

  2. Parable of the Good Samaritan (Luke 10:25-37): Reflect on this parable in the context of justice and fairness. How does this story challenge your understanding of who deserves your help and compassion? How can you apply its lessons to modern issues of inequality?

  3. Proverbs 31:8-9: "Speak up for those who cannot speak for themselves, for the rights of all who are destitute. Speak up and judge fairly; defend the rights of the poor and needy." How do these verses guide your perspective on advocacy and justice? Can you recall an instance when you stood up for someone? What was the outcome?

  4. Reflect on James 2:1-9: This passage criticizes favoritism and emphasizes the importance of treating others equally. How do you see favoritism manifesting in your community, and what steps can you take to counteract it in your own interactions?

  5. Old Testament Law (Deuteronomy 16:20): "Follow justice and justice alone, so that you may live and possess the land the Lord your God is giving you." How do you interpret the importance of justice in receiving God’s blessings? In what ways does this shape your view of the relationship between faith and justice?

  6. Reflect on Isaiah 1:17: "Learn to do right; seek justice. Defend the oppressed. Take up the cause of the fatherless; plead the case of the widow." How does this command shape your view of social responsibility? What practical steps can you take to follow this directive in your community?

  7. Jesus and the Adulterous Woman (John 8:1-11): Consider the way Jesus responded to the woman caught in adultery. How does His example shape your understanding of justice, mercy, and fairness? How do you balance justice and forgiveness in your own life?

  8. Reflect on Zechariah 7:9-10: "This is what the Lord Almighty said: ‘Administer true justice; show mercy and compassion to one another. Do not oppress the widow or the fatherless, the foreigner or the poor. Do not plot evil against each other.’" How do these instructions inform your actions and attitudes towards those who are marginalized or vulnerable?

Take time to meditate on these scriptures, write your thoughts, and consider how you can incorporate biblical principles of justice and fairness into your everyday life.
